In most cases, foot warts are not … WebApr 3, 2024 · Plantar warts are a skin growth caused by a viral infection called the human papillomavirus, or HPV. The growths form on the bottom of the foot and are solid and grainy or bumpy in appearance. Also known as verruca plantaris or simply verruca, plantar warts typically form at the heel, toe, or ball of the foot.

WebNov 14, 2024 · Buy salicylic acid lotion or gel at your local pharmacy. Wash your feet, soak them, then exfoliate the hard skin over the plantar wart with a pumice stone. This allows the salicylic acid to penetrate the plantar wart. Allow the lotion or gel to dry completely before you cover your foot or walk around. [6]
